The South Oklahoma City District blends urban ministries with small town and rural ministries. Several universities (Oklahoma University, USAO, Oklahoma Baptist University, St. Gregory’s University) within the district and other in near-by areas serve the higher education needs. The SOKC District is a very diverse district culturally, geographically, demographically and economically.

The Churches of the SOKC District, for the most part, mirror the diversity of the region. There are churches in county seat towns; urban, city churches, all south of 23rd Street in Oklahoma City; two large churches in the metro area and several medium sized throughout the district; numerous small churches, both rural and city, totaling 50 churches. The geography of the district covers portions of Oklahoma, McClain, Cleveland, Grady, Canadian, and Pottawatomie counties. Our website seeks to introduce you to the churches of the SOKC District!
